Role

Reporting to the Nursery Manager, you will play a key role in the daily life of the setting, including:

  • Delivering high-quality care and education in line with the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S) framework
  • Supporting children's learning, development, and emotional wellbeing
  • Planning and delivering engaging, age-appropriate activities
  • Observing, assessing, and recording children's progress
  • Creating a safe, inclusive, and nurturing environment
  • Collaborating effectively with colleagues and parents

Requirements

  • Level 2 or Level 3 qualified in Early Years
  • Confident in their knowledge and application of the EYFS
  • Passionate about working with young children
  • Strong communicators and effective team players
  • Committed to safeguarding and promoting children's welfare

How to prepare for a job interview at Thrive Recruitment Group

✨Know Your EYFS Inside Out

Make sure you brush up on the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S) framework before your interview. Be ready to discuss how you've applied it in your previous roles and share specific examples of activities you've planned that align with EYFS principles.

✨Show Your Passion for Early Years Education

During the interview, let your enthusiasm for working with young children shine through. Share stories that highlight your commitment to their development and emotional wellbeing. This will help demonstrate that you're not just qualified, but genuinely passionate about making a difference.

✨Prepare Questions for Your Interviewers

Think of thoughtful questions to ask your interviewers about the nursery's approach to education and care. This shows that you're engaged and interested in their specific setting, plus it gives you valuable insights into whether it's the right fit for you.

✨Highlight Your Teamwork Skills

Since collaboration is key in early years settings, be prepared to discuss how you've worked effectively with colleagues and parents in the past. Share examples of how you’ve contributed to a positive team environment and supported others in delivering high-quality care.
